Hold Back The River - Chapter 7

Betty decided not to tell anyone about her upcoming coffee with Jughead - not that there was a lot of time in which she could have told anyone even if she wanted to. She kept quiet as Midge wiggled her eyebrows at her at the bar. She didn’t text Kevin. She passed on her weekly phone call with her mom, promising to ring another night instead.

She’d been starting to feel like her life was under a bit of a microscope – more than usual at least. She didn’t want to spend the night musing over what might be about to happen, what he might say – any explanations, or not, that she might hear. She knew that, despite his best intentions and his unwavering support, Kevin would want to go into every detail about her interaction with Jughead and what he thought it meant. Right now, she couldn’t do that.

She was took exhausted to analyse anything anymore. She’d spent years of her life wondering and now she had a small chance to find out something– so she was keeping it to herself. There was also the weird sense of loyalty she felt to Jughead, despite everything. He’d been the one to approach her this time, which he’d clearly not found easy, so she didn’t want to broadcast it out to anyone.

Well, at least not until she had the facts.
